Is Pirelli a luxury tire?
Yes. Pirelli tires are premium-quality products, offering excellent handling, comfort, and performance. Built with drivers of luxury vehicles and sports cars in mind, and are often included as original equipment. Unlike some previous eras, where multiple tyre manufacturers competed against each other and created what was known as a ‘tyre war’, Pirelli are now F1’s sole, exclusive supplier, with an agreement running through the end of the 2027 campaign.
What is better, Pirelli or Bridgestone?
Drivers praise Pirelli for its high-speed stability, grip, and noise reduction, especially on premium vehicles. Bridgestone receives accolades for its durability, all-weather reliability, and versatility across different driving conditions. Tread life and durability: Michelin tyres are renowned for their exceptional tread life and durability, outlasting many competitors. Pirelli tyres also offer good tread life and durability, although they may not match Michelin’s longevity. Both brands prioritize durability, with Michelin having a slight edge.While some drivers may experience faster wear with Pirelli tires, others may find them durable and long-lasting. Regular tire maintenance, proper inflation, and rotation can help maximize the lifespan of Pirelli tires.

The tire industry has developed an informal working shorthand for categorizing tire manufacturers. Tier 1 Brands are typically considered to be Michelin, Bridgestone, and Goodyear – but in part that is due to the fact that they are the 3 biggest-selling brands.
How much does a F1 Pirelli tire cost?
How much do F1 tyres cost? According to Motorsport Magazine, Head of Pirelli Motorsport Mario Isola confirmed that each tire costs €600. Translated to USD, this figure would be approximately $625. Using those figures, a set of four F1 tires would cost an estimated $2500.
